#d4bb16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4bb16 is composed of 83.1% red, 73.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 52.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#d4bb16 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2c with #a97700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

● #d4bb16 color description : Strong yellow.
#d4bb16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4bb16 has RGB values of R:212, G:187,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.9,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13941526.

Shades and Tints of #d4bb16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110f02 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4bb16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7970 is the less saturated color, while #e6c804 is the most saturated one.
